A computable structure A is x-computably categorical for some Turing degree x, if for every computable structure B ∼= A there is an isomorphism f : B → A with f ≤T x. A degree x is a degree of categoricity if there is a computable structure A such that A is x-computably categorical, and for all y, if A is y-computably categorical then x ≤T y.
